Come and join our One Great Team here at Haven as a Security Team Member!
As part of our Security Team, you will…
- Conduct regular perimeter patrols and perform regular safety and fire-equipment checks
- Ensure guests holidays are not disrupted by maintaining acceptable noise levels in and around caravans
- Assist customers with enquiries
- Check membership passes
- Complete control logs and reports

Great opportunity to work as a Security Officer for G4S, a leading global security and outsourcing group, specialising in outsourcing of business processes in sectors where security and safety risks are considered a strategic threat.
G4S is recruiting for a Security Officer to work in Cardiff.
The rate of pay is £11.44 per hour, working Mon-Fri from 12:00-20:00..
This is a full-time, permanent role.
**Please note you must be over the age of 18 to apply for this role**
Your Time at Work
As a Security Officer, your duties will include:
- Patrols of the site externally
- Responding to security incidents on site
- Maintaining customer security standards
- Liaising with relevant authorities where appropriate
- Access and egress control
Our Perfect Worker
Our perfect worker is a confident communicator who is a team player with the drive to provide a friendly and professional service at all times. Good IT knowledge is also key.
It would be a benefit to have some security experience and your SIA licence, however it's not essential, as we provide full SIA (Security Industry Authority) licence training.
